Last week I downloaded the Fedora Core 3 isos to my windows pc hardrive. All of the checksums were good so I burnt the cd's without any problem. I am installing them on a system that was running RH 8.0 and started from scratch. I got all of the way thru the 2nd disk and inserted the 3rd disk. It started and when I came back in the room it had stopped the install with an error that the media had an error or the harddisk was full. The harddisk is 22 Gig so it should not have had a problem. I had not done a media check on disk 3 so I did one when the system restarted with disk 1. The media check said that the cd 3 was bad so just to make sure it did not happen again I re-downloaded the 3rd iso from another site on my windos pc while I re-started the install with cd1. This new download had a good checksum and I burned it to a new cd. this time I put in the new 3rd cd when ask for and when I came back into the room it was stopped with the same error. I beleive it was on the same file as before. I did a media check on it and it showed to be good. The only thing that seems to be consistant is they both blew off around the same file. Something like QT3-3.3.3.

Any ideas would be welcome.
